Chapter 22 - Electric Fields - Problems - Page 656: 49b

Answer

The direction of the force is $~~-11.3^{\circ}$

Work Step by Step

We can find the electrostatic force in unit-vector notation: $F = q~E$ $F = (8.00\times 10^{-5}~C)~(3000~\hat{i} - 600~\hat{j})~N/C$ $F = (0.240~\hat{i} - 0.048~\hat{j})~N$ We can find the direction of the force as an angle $\theta$ below the positive x axis: $tan~\theta = \frac{0.048}{0.240}$ $\theta = tan^{-1}~(\frac{0.048}{0.240})$ $\theta = 11.3^{\circ}$ The direction of the force is $~~-11.3^{\circ}$.
